代码可管理性是 Web 开发中最重要的因素。如果您正在构建具有大型代码库的应用程序,则管理该代码库并不容易。通常,您必须滚动浏览数百甚至数千行代码,这使得调试过程非常困难。 怎么样?我们将一项任务分配给一个功能,并将其中一些功能保存在一个文件(组件)中。幸运的是,JavaScript 以导入和导出语句的形式解决了这个问题。 JavaScript 中的模块是一小段代码,是一段可重
转载
2024-05-27 22:29:47
193阅读
在JavaScript中,`import`语句的加载位置的处理是一个至关重要的主题,它直接影响到模块之间的依赖关系和加载效率。随着ECMAScript标准的演进,`import`的工作方式有了显著变化。本文将通过版本对比、迁移指南、兼容性处理、实战案例、排错指南和生态扩展等多个方面,深入探讨JavaScript中`import`的加载位置问题。
### 版本对比
在不同版本的JavaScrip
From:https://segmentfault.com/a/1190000018249137?utm_source=
转载
2022-10-12 12:48:41
102阅读
## PyCharm中JavaScript如何采用import
### 问题描述
在使用PyCharm进行JavaScript开发时,我们通常会遇到需要引入外部的JavaScript库或模块的情况。在ES6标准中,可以使用`import`语法来引入外部模块,但在一些旧版本的浏览器中并不支持该语法。因此,我们需要一种方法来在PyCharm中使用`import`语法,同时能够确保代码在各种浏览器中
原创
2023-09-08 10:58:35
111阅读
详解JavaScript中的模块、Import和Export前端小混混前端先锋//每日前端夜话第436篇//正文共:3000字//预计阅读时间:12分钟在互联网的洪荒时代,网站主要用HTML和CSS开发的。如果将JavaScript加载到页面中,通常是以小片段的形式提供效果和交互,一般会把所有的JavaScript代码全都写在一个文件中,并加载到一个script标签中。尽管可以把JavaScrip
原创
2021-01-28 14:44:17
468阅读
.在互联网的洪荒时代,网站主要用HTML和CSS开发的。如果将JavaScript加载到页面中,通常是以小片段的形式提供效果和交互,一般会把所有的JavaScript代码全都写在一个文件中,并加载到一个script标签中。尽管可以把JavaScript拆分为多个文件,但是所有的变量和函数仍然会被添加到全局作用域中。但是后来JavaScript在浏览器中发挥着重要的作用,迫切需要使用第三方代码来完成
原创
2021-01-09 20:42:19
423阅读
prototype属性可算是JavaScript与其他面向对象语言的一大不同之处。 prototype就是“一个给类的对象添加方法的方法”,使用prototype属性,可以给类动态地添加方法,以便在JavaScript中实现“继承”的效果。 具体来说,prototype 是在 IE 4 及其以后版本引入的一个针对于某一类的对象的方法,当你用prototy
转载
2023-11-13 20:57:19
48阅读
# 如何在JavaScript中导入图片
## 介绍
作为一名经验丰富的开发者,我将教你如何在JavaScript中导入图片。这个过程并不复杂,只需按照一定的步骤操作即可实现。
### 整体流程
首先,我们来看一下整体的流程。下面的表格展示了如何导入图片的步骤:
| 步骤 | 操作 |
| ---- | ---- |
| 1 | 创建img标签 |
| 2 | 设置img标签的src属性 |
原创
2024-02-28 04:35:56
232阅读
export和importexport分为命名导出(多个)和默认导出(一个),用于暴露模块内容。import需与导出方式匹配,支持命名导入、默认导入、整体导入等。动态import()支持按需加载,适合性能优化。掌握这些语法能帮助你写出更清晰、可维护的大型 JavaScript 应用。
# 如何在iOS中导入JavaScript
## 介绍
作为一名经验丰富的开发者,我们经常需要在iOS应用中嵌入JavaScript代码来实现一些特定功能。在这篇文章中,我将向你展示如何在iOS应用中导入JavaScript,并解释每个步骤的具体操作和代码示例。
## 流程图
```mermaid
flowchart TD
A(开始)
B(创建新项目)
C(导入Java
原创
2024-06-19 05:53:45
67阅读
# 实现JavaScript中的JSON导入
## 引言
JSON(JavaScript Object Notation)是一种用于数据交换的轻量级数据格式,它易于人们阅读和编写,同时也易于机器解析和生成。在实际的开发中,我们经常需要导入JSON数据并在JavaScript中使用。本文将介绍如何在JavaScript中导入JSON数据。
## 流程概览
下面是实现"javascript imp
原创
2023-08-13 13:20:19
730阅读
# JavaScript import 原理解析
作为一名经验丰富的开发者,我将帮助你理解 JavaScript 的 import 原理。在开始之前,让我们先了解整个过程的流程。
## 流程图
下面的表格展示了 JavaScript import 的实现步骤。
| 步骤 | 描述 |
| --- | --- |
| 1 | 创建一个模块文件 |
| 2 | 导出需要公开的变量、函数或类 |
原创
2023-07-21 17:58:47
300阅读
脚本和模块JavaScript 有两种源文件,一种叫做脚本,一种叫做模块。这个区分是在 ES6 引入了模块机制开始的,在 ES5 和之前的版本中,就只有一种源文件类型(就只有脚本)。脚本是可以由浏览器或者 node 环境引入执行的,而模块只能由 JavaScript 代码用 import 引入执行。实际上模块和脚本之间的区别仅仅在于是否包含 import 和 export。import 声明 我们
转载
2023-10-09 00:01:32
190阅读
转
importimport 和 require 的区别import 和js的发展历史息息相关,历史上 js没有模块(module)体系,无法将一个大程序拆分成互相依赖的小文件,再用简单的方法拼装起来。这对开发大型工程非常不方便。在 ES6 之前,社区制定了一些模块加载方案,最主要的有 CommonJS 和 AMD 两种。前者用于服务器,后者用于浏览器
转载
2023-12-20 00:40:22
543阅读
在现代JavaScript开发中,模块化管理是提升代码可维护性和可读性的重要策略。如何有效地进行"JavaScript import 目录"的管理,值得深入探讨。本文将系统地阐述环境准备、集成步骤、配置详解、实战应用、排错指南及生态扩展的整个过程。
### 环境准备
在准备开发环境时,需要确保具备以下依赖,并安装对应版本。依赖的选择与版本兼容性如下。
```markdown
| 依赖名称
转
import
import 和 require 的区别
import 和js的发展历史息息相关,历史上 js没有模块(module)体系,无法将一个大程序拆分成互相依赖的小文件,再用简单的方法拼装起来。这对开发大型工程非常不方便。
在 ES6 之前,社区制定了一些模块加载方案,最主要的有 CommonJS 和 AMD 两种。前者用于服务器,后者用于浏览器。ES6 在语言标准的层面上,实现了模块
模块的概念一个模块就是一个文件,一个脚本就是一个模块模块可以相互加载,使用特殊的指令 export 和 import 就可以实现交换功能,从另一个模块调用一个模块的函数:
export 关键字标记了可以从当前模块外部访问的变量和函数。
import 关键字允许从其他模块导入功能。例如有一个exprot.js文件导出一个函数export function sayHi(user) {
alert(
转载
2023-12-31 13:37:08
490阅读
写在前面,目前浏览器对ES6的import支持还不是很好,需要用bable转译。 ES6引入外部模块分两种情况: 1.导入外部的变量或函数等;import {firstName, lastName, year} from './profile'; 2.导入外部的模块,并立即执行import './test'
//执行test.js,但不导入任何变量 第2种情况就不用讲了,就是执行从头到
转载
2023-12-02 23:02:27
387阅读
importimport是python提供的用于导入模块的机制,导入的是整个模块的内容。模块可以是py、pyc、pyd,可以是系统自带的,也可以是自定义的。使用语法:import os
python中所有加载到内存的模块都存放到sys.modules中,在引入一个模块之前,会先在列表中查找是否已经加载了该模块,如果已经加载则只用将模块的名字加入到正在调用import模块的local名字空间中;没有
转载
2023-06-21 16:24:25
83阅读
python社区不乏幽默。先来看“python之道”这首诗。导入this包:import this 输出是一首诗, 这首诗总结了Python的风格,能够指导Python程序猿的编程。
以下是译文:The Zen of Python, by Tim Peters
Python之道
Beautiful is better than ugly.
美观胜于丑陋。
Explici
转载
2023-08-25 08:19:44
156阅读